Job Description

We are seeking an experienced and detail-oriented Trust and Estates Paralegal to support attorneys and clients in managing complex estate and trust administration matters across the DC, Maryland, and Virginia regions.

Job Overview
As a Trust and Estates Paralegal, you will play a key role in assisting attorneys with the preparation, management, and filing of important documents and paperwork related to estate planning, trust administration, and probate matters. You will work closely with clients and professionals, offering support in a fast-paced, client-focused environment.

Key Responsibilities
Draft, edit, and review essential probate and estate administration documents, including petitions for probate, inventories, accountings, and tax returns.
Manage trust administration tasks such as accountings and filing fiduciary income tax returns.
Engage with clients via in-person meetings, phone calls, emails, and video conferencing.
Gather and organize detailed information about the assets and debts of estates and trusts.
Prepare and organize financial records for estate tax returns and audits.
Prepare, review, and edit estate tax returns.
Draft accountings and settlement papers for both informal and formal estate and trust settlements.

Qualifications
3-5 years of experience as a Trust and Estate Paralegal with expertise in fiduciary accountings and tax preparation.
Notary license (MD preferred).
Strong commun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to interact effectively with clients and team members.
Exceptional organ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ple tasks independently while maintaining attention to detail.
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and Adobe Acrobat.
A high level of discretion and sensitivity when handling confidential information.
Willingness to work outside of normal business hours, when necessary, to meet client needs.
